WebFeb 7, 2024 · Prokaryotic cells have a single circular chromosome, no nucleus, and few other cell structures. Eukaryotic cells, in contrast, have multiple chromosomes contained within a nucleus, and many other organelles. All of these cell parts must be duplicated and then separated when the cell divides. WebJun 20, 2024 · Are earthworms eukaryotic? Earthworms belong to the Animalia kingdom. They are multicellular organisms that are also eukaryotic; this means that their cells have nuclei. Is parasitic worms eukaryotic or prokaryotic? Parasites are part of a large group of organisms called eukaryotes.

WebMonera (/məˈnɪərə/) (Greek - μονήρης (monḗrēs), "single", "solitary") is a biological kingdom that is made up of prokaryotes. As such, it is composed of single-celled organisms that lack a nucleus . The taxon Monera was first proposed as a phylum by Ernst Haeckel in 1866.
